THE CEREMONIES FOR CANDLEMAS DAY

by Robert Herrick

Kindle the Christmas brand, and then

Till sunset let it burn;

Which quench'd, then lay it up again,

Till Christmas next return.

Part must be kept, wherewith to teend

The Christmas log next year;

And where 'tis safely kept, the fiend

Can do no mischief there.
